Woodlands Lake is a private community lake within The Woodlands planned community - it is managed by The Woodlands community organization as an amenity for residents and subject to the community's specific architectural and construction standards for waterfront modifications. The Woodlands' premium planned community character and its HOA-governed waterfront standards create a specific construction context for this suburban Houston lake.
The Woodlands is one of the most regulated planned communities in Texas - The Woodlands Development Company and the applicable community association have specific architectural review requirements for any waterfront modification, dock construction, or retaining wall installation within the lake's management zone.
